虚拟机全局安装yarn
介绍
在进行前端开发时,我们经常会用到yarn作为包管理工具。为了在多个项目中共享yarn的命令行工具,我们可以将yarn安装在全局环境中。本文将介绍如何在虚拟机中全局安装yarn。
准备工作
在开始之前,请确保你已经在虚拟机中安装了Node.js和npm。如果你还没有安装,请参考官方文档进行安装。
安装yarn
- 首先,我们需要使用npm来全局安装yarn。打开虚拟机的终端,并执行以下命令:
npm install -g yarn
这会将yarn安装到全局环境中,并将其可执行文件添加到系统的PATH中。
- 安装完成后,你可以使用以下命令来验证yarn是否成功安装:
yarn --version
如果成功安装,终端将显示yarn的版本号。
使用yarn
现在,你可以在任何项目中使用yarn了。以下是一些常用的yarn命令:
- 初始化一个新项目
yarn init
这会在当前目录下创建一个新的package.json文件,并引导你填写项目信息。
- 安装依赖包
yarn add [package]
这会在当前项目中安装指定的依赖包,并将其添加到package.json文件的dependencies中。
- 安装开发依赖包
yarn add --dev [package]
这会在当前项目中安装指定的开发依赖包,并将其添加到package.json文件的devDependencies中。
- 更新依赖包
yarn upgrade [package]
这会更新指定的依赖包至最新版本。
- 移除依赖包
yarn remove [package]
这会从当前项目中移除指定的依赖包,并将其从package.json文件中删除。
总结
在本文中,我们介绍了如何在虚拟机中全局安装yarn,并展示了一些常用的yarn命令。通过将yarn安装在全局环境中,你可以在多个项目中共享yarn的命令行工具,提高开发效率。
类图
```mermaid
classDiagram
class VirtualMachine {
+name: string
+installYarn(): void
+useYarn(): void
}
class Yarn {
+version: string
+init(): void
+add(package: string): void
+addDev(package: string): void
+upgrade(package: string): void
+remove(package: string): void
}
VirtualMachine "1" --> "1" Yarn